A sampling of Monday’s ratings changes and new coverage by securities analysts:

* Alcoa (ticker symbol: AA) and Reynolds Metals (RLM) were downgraded to “hold” from “strong buy” by CIBC Oppenheimer.

* Daimler-Benz (DAI), General Motors (GM) and Ford Motor (F) were rated “buy” in new coverage by Wasserstein Perella Securities, with 12-month target prices of $96, $73 and $62, respectively.

* Hewlett-Packard (HWP) was raised to “strong buy” from “neutral” by SG Cowen, with a 12-month target of $75.

* Kellogg (K) was downgraded to “sell” from “hold” by Credit Suisse First Boston.

* Medtronic was downgraded to “hold” from “buy” by Credit Suisse First Boston.
